Output dabc500063c608b87e1899d96315797368cab8b7976f541ec4d513dc7b41c968:1

value
22504526
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e582690a49d0f07e051894606495e184e3c208df OP_EQUALVERIFY OP_CHECKSIG
address
1MvXxzoVvGkcCXgZtHAr1rYMi4zgB6Nw5D
transaction
dabc500063c608b87e1899d96315797368cab8b7976f541ec4d513dc7b41c968
confirmations
441934
spent
true